I have a couple of different digital thermometers and the variation can be anywhere upto +/- 2 degrees. I want to be able to use a digital thermometer so I can be accurate when incubating some python eggs. This amount of variation can obviously be detrimental.
What digital thermometers do you use and how do you know that the temperature being displayed is that temp?
Any brands to stay away from or any that are great and are a must have?
